Output 5fd6e6630c8119c4eb17d65ab90559b3c557c4c5c486df4de89efb942dfba979:47

value
65236
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d50edebb77377e26e066c7ea729c9f577d724a2e OP_EQUAL
address
3M7ZfbL2sffv7wjbiTfdUey1V1UfBXXwEE
transaction
5fd6e6630c8119c4eb17d65ab90559b3c557c4c5c486df4de89efb942dfba979
spent
true